What to Eat
Amravati is known for its delicious cuisine. Some of the popular dishes that you must try include:
- Amravati poha: This is a popular breakfast dish made from flattened rice, onions, tomatoes, and spices.
- Shev bhaji: This is a traditional Maharashtrian dish made from vermicelli noodles, vegetables, and spices.
- Misal pav: This is a spicy dish made from a mixture of sprouts, potatoes, and onions served with a bread roll.
- Vada pav: This is a popular street food dish made from a potato patty served in a bread roll.
- Dahi vada: This is a savory snack made from lentil dumplings served in a yogurt sauce.
Where to Go
There are many places to visit in Amravati. Some of the most popular tourist attractions include:
- Ambadevi Temple: This is a Hindu temple dedicated to the goddess Ambadevi. It is one of the most popular pilgrimage sites in Maharashtra.
- Chikhaldara Hill Station: This is a hill station located in the Melghat Tiger Reserve. It is a popular destination for trekking and nature lovers.
- Ghatanji Temple: This is a Jain temple located in the village of Ghatanji. It is known for its beautiful architecture and sculptures.
